One Pot Synthesis of Some New Heteroylselenoglycolic Acids and Their Biological Activity

A convenient one pot three-stage synthesis was used for obtaining new heteroylselenoglycolic and di-heteroylselenoglycolic acids by nucleophilic substitution reaction of the starting compounds pyridineselenol, pyridazineselenol, and quinolineselenol with -chloro- or ,-dichloroacetic acids for 1-h stirring. The newly synthesized compounds were screened biologically for anti-microbial and anti-oxidant activities. The structure of all new compounds was confirmed by H-1 NMR, C-13 NMR, Mass, and IR spectroscopy and elemental analyses.
